Review of About Schmidt (2002) by Greg L — 20 Nov 2008
Look, the fact that it's slow, should have no effect on the movie's quality. Was it slow? Yes, but that has nothing to do with the overall movie. The humor in it, to start off, was great. It's darker at times, and more subtle than the mainstream comedy movies have to offer.
Jack Nicholson's performance undisputably was spot on. Not to mention Kathy Bates was hilarious as the transcendental in-law. It is more thought provoking than most comedies you see nowadays. It had a specific, and deep point to it that a lot of comedies cannot pull off.
Great film.
